Paul Donaldson and Snake Jagger open joint exhibition at Hi-Desert Artists Gallery

Two lifelong hi-desert artists are reuniting for their third joint exhibition in the Hi-Desert art scene. Paul Donaldson and Snake Jagger bring their latest works to the Hi-Desert Artists Gallery in Old Town Yucca Valley, offering an engaging exploration of portraiture and personal vision.
The opening reception will be held tonight from 5:00 to 7:00 p.m., and the gallery is inviting the community to meet the artists and experience their newest collections.
The Hi-Desert Artists Gallery says that Donaldson will present a compelling series of portraits featuring local residents and artisans from the Hi-Desert community. Rendered in his signature style, the works capture both the character and spirit of the individuals who help shape the region’s creative identity.


Jagger will showcase a retrospective of his distinctive “whimsical surrealism,” highlighting imaginative desert landscapes alongside select portrait works. The gallery says that his pieces blend dreamlike elements with familiar surroundings, offering viewers a playful yet thought-provoking perspective on the desert environment.


The show runs March 20 through April 14.
